This patch adds support to the Linux kernel (tested on 2.4.18, 2.4.19-pre3 = and 2.4.19-pre3-ac1) for the Belkin F5D6000 "Wireless Desktop PCI Network Adapt= er". This is a PLX PCI9502 based PCMCIA adapter that allows 802.11b wireless net= work cards (mainly Prism2 based, like the Belkin F5D6020) to work on desktop box= en. This patch would be a great addition to the appropriate packages, including= the Linux kernel as Belkins components tend to be low cost and high quality, as well as widely available. The patch contents are basically an addition to orinoco_plx.c so that it recognizes the IO Addresses of the Belkin F5D6000 and configures it appropriately. It is a small patch but it does the trick; I have tested it extensively on my Linux box in both Managed and Ad-Hoc modes with a Belkin F5D6020 card. It has been applied and tested (as aformentioned) against 2.4.18, 2.4.19-pr= e3 and 2.4.19-pre3-ac1.
